Output d0faaa1eff2ff5bbca60f68d24d3fdc8ccd0a87e7719776141063ac80c15b9e7:0

value
744754423
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c5607ff79ad5d9a60ec315fd34f8b09fb227ea0 OP_EQUAL
address
MLhBtqnX6fzaeBfeDemGXwihdTk1TCB4av
transaction
d0faaa1eff2ff5bbca60f68d24d3fdc8ccd0a87e7719776141063ac80c15b9e7
spent
true